Mount Onigajo

Mount Onigajo, Mountain summit in Uwajima, Japan.

Mount Onigajo is a mountain summit in Ehime Prefecture that rises to 1,151 meters, with forest-covered slopes cut by rocky trails that lead through dense woodland. Multiple hiking routes connect different starting points around the region, offering walkers various ways to approach the peak.

The mountain is connected to ancient Japanese folklore that tells of Onihonmaru, a demon said to have lived in the rocky terrain centuries ago. These stories have been passed down through generations and continue to shape how people view and experience the place today.

The mountain draws visitors who seek out the small shrines tucked into the forested slopes, which serve as quiet places for reflection and connection to the land. These sacred sites remain important waypoints along the hiking routes where people pause to offer quiet respect.

Plan for a full hiking circuit of about nine to ten hours, and wear sturdy boots with good grip since rocky sections are common throughout the trails. Starting early in the day gives you plenty of daylight and allows for a comfortable pace without rushing.

Winter snow transforms the slopes into an unexpected northern landscape, creating a stark contrast to the subtropical area below on warmer days. This surprising seasonal shift catches many visitors off guard who are unprepared for the cold conditions at higher elevations.
